We are working with a well-established, growing property consultancy based in Plymouth that is looking to strengthen its team with the addition of a talented Building Surveyor and potentially a second hire. This is an excellent opportunity for someone early in their career who wants hands-on project exposure, responsibility, and a clear path for progression within a supportive consultancy environment.

The Role

  • Contract administration
  • Project delivery
  • Professional surveying services
  • Client-facing responsibilities across a varied portfolio

What We’re Looking For

  • 2-3+ years experience post relevant degree
  • Ideally recently passed APC or working towards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ors chartership
  • Background within a consultancy (essential)
  • Some exposure to contract administration and/or project management
  • Experience across multiple sectors is beneficial but not essential

Additional Opportunity

There is flexibility to hire a second individual, potentially from a Project Management background, so we’re keen to hear from candidates with complementary experience as well.

Salary £40,000 - £55,000 depending on experience

Location Plymouth (office-based with site visits)

How to prepare for a job interview at Build Maintain Recruit Limited

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of building surveying principles and practices. Familiarise yourself with the specific projects the consultancy has worked on, as well as any recent developments in the industry. This will show that you're genuinely interested and prepared.

Showcase Your Experience

Be ready to discuss your previous roles and how they relate to the position. Highlight any contract administration or project management experience you have, even if it's limited. Use specific examples to demonstrate your skills and how they can benefit the consultancy.

Ask Smart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the consultancy's projects, team dynamics, and growth opportunities. This not only shows your enthusiasm but also hel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you. Think about what you want to know regarding their approach to client-facing responsibilities.

Dress the Part

Even though it’s a consultancy environment, first impressions matter. Dress professionally to convey that you take the opportunity seriously. A smart appearance can help set a positive tone for the interview and reflect your understanding of the industry standards.
